While 6.0.1000 is a great piece of software history, using it on a modern machine today is like using a shield from the Middle Ages to stop a laser. Cyber threats have evolved massively, and older versions lack the virus definitions needed to stop 2024-era malware.
The term frequently appears in historical software archives alongside this specific Avast build. In the software community, a "RePack" refers to an official installer that has been modified or pre-configured by a third party.

Repacked files are a common vehicle for spyware, keyloggers, and ransomware . While it may look like the original program, hidden malicious code can operate in the background to steal data or compromise your system.
